ZVVQ代理分享网

前端开发中如何设置滚动条样式?

作者:zvvq博客网
导读background-color:f1f1f1;background-color:888;其中,“width”和“height”属性用来设置滚动条的宽度和高度,“background-color”属性用来设置滚动条的背景色,“border-radius”属性用来设置滚动条滑

在前端开发中,我们经常需要对网页中的滚动条进行样式的设置。默认情况下,浏览器的滚动条样式可能并不符合我们的设计需求,因此需要通过CSS来进行自定义样式的设置。

在CSS中,我们可以通过以下代码来设置滚动条的样式:

```

/ 设置滚动条的宽度和高度 /

::-webkit-scrollbar {

width: 0px;

height: 0px;

}

/ 设置滚动条的背景色 /

::-webkit-scrollbar-track {

background-color: fff;

}

/ 设置滚动条滑块的背景色 /

::-webkit-scrollbar-thumb {

background-color: ;

}

/ 设置滚动条滑块的圆角 /

::-webkit-scrollbar-thumb {

border-radius: px;

}

```

上述代码中,我们使用了伪类选择器“::-webkit-scrollbar”来选择滚动条,并对其进行样式的设置。其中,“width”和“height”属性用来设置滚动条的宽度和高度,“background-color”属性用来设置滚动条的背景色,“border-radius”属性用来设置滚动条滑块的圆角。

除了上述代码外,我们还可以通过CSS的一些新特性来进行更加丰富的滚动条样式设置。例如,我们可以使用“overflow-scrolling”属性来设置滚动条的滑动效果:

```

/ 设置滚动条的滑动效果 /

body {

-webkit-overflow-scrolling: touch;

}

```

上述代码中,我们使用了“-webkit-overflow-scrolling”属性来设置滚动条的滑动效果为“touch”,这样可以让网页在移动设备上更加流畅地进行滚动。

除了上述代码外,我们还可以使用CSS中的“transform”属性来对滚动条进行更加复杂的变换效果:

```

/ 对滚动条进行旋转变换 /

::-webkit-scrollbar-thumb {

transform: rotate(deg);

}

```

上述代码中,我们使用了“transform”属性对滚动条滑块进行了旋转变换,使其呈现出斜向的效果。

总之,通过CSS的样式设置,我们可以对网页中的滚动条进行丰富多彩的自定义样式设置,让网页在视觉上更加美观、更加符合设计需求。

    展开全文